Exceptional Strength and Durability

One of the primary advantages of high strength polyethylene yarn is its exceptional strength, which can be several times stronger than steel when compared on a weight-for-weight basis. This makes it a perfect choice for applications where safety and reliability are paramount. For example, in maritime industries, high strength polyethylene yarn is used to create ropes that can withstand extreme forces without fraying or breaking, ensuring both safety and longevity.

Lightweight Composition

Another significant benefit of high strength polyethylene yarn is its lightweight nature. Weighing significantly less than traditional materials, high strength polyethylene yarn allows for easier handling and transport. This characteristic is particularly advantageous for industries like aerospace and automotive, where every gram matters. For instance, manufacturers can produce lighter components without compromising strength, leading to improved fuel efficiency in aircraft and vehicles.

Resistance to Environmental Factors

High strength polyethylene yarn boasts excellent resistance to various environmental factors, making it a durable choice for outdoor applications. It is resistant to UV radiation, moisture, and chemicals, which means it does not easily degrade over time. This property is especially beneficial for outdoor gear, such as tents and canopies, which are constantly exposed to sun, rain, and temperature fluctuations. Versatile Application Range

The versatility of high strength polyethylene yarn makes it suitable for a wide range of applications. It is commonly used in sports equipment, such as fishing lines and climbing ropes, due to its superior strength and lightweight features. Additionally, the textile industry uses high strength polyethylene yarn for producing durable fabrics, while the medical field utilizes it for sutures and other applications requiring high tensile strength. This broad applicability means that various industries can benefit from integrating high strength polyethylene yarn into their products.

How does high strength polyethylene yarn compare to traditional materials?

High strength polyethylene yarn outperforms many traditional materials in terms of strength, weight, and durability. It is lighter and has a higher strength-to-weight ratio than materials like nylon or polyester, ultimately leading to stronger and lighter products.

Is high strength polyethylene yarn environmentally friendly?

While high strength polyethylene yarn itself is not biodegradable, its durability means it can be used for long periods, reducing the need for frequent replacements. Companies are increasingly looking for sustainable practices in the production of this yarn to minimize environmental impact.
